What is a DVR?

A DVR (Disability Vocational Rehabilitation) job involves helping individuals with disabilities gain and maintain employment. DVR professionals assess clients' skills, provide job training, and coordinate with employers to create inclusive work environments. They also assist with career counseling, resume development, and workplace accommodations. The goal is to support individuals in achieving long-term employment and independence.

Job description

Summary of Position:

The Warehouse Associate performs the physical and administrative tasks involving warehousing, shipping, receiving, installation, order fulfillment of products, supplies and equipment.

Key Responsibilities:

Warehousing

  • Maintain warehouse as a neat, clean, and safe working environment
  • Organize product, bin, lot, packaging supply, and equipment locations

Shipping and Receiving

  • Unpack and check goods received against purchase orders or invoices
  • Report discrepancies accurately and in a timely manner
  • Accurately pick products based on part numbers and quantities on pick lists
  • Pack shipments with care and efficiency in mind, in the most effective manner possible to minimize shipping cost and ensure product safety and adhere to company’s double check policy.
  • Ensure products shipped out are in accordance with approved orders and specifications
  • Familiarize with the company invoicing process
  • Ensure that all daily orders are accurately fulfilled in a timely manner, with correct documentation
  • Maintain awareness of circumstances that may impede the timely fulfillment of daily orders
  • Assist with tracking of shipments when needed
  • Familiarize with FedEx, UPS, USPS, Freight, Int'l shipments, customs process
  • Coordinate trucking shipments

Installation

  • Install hard drives, update firmware, and test DVR and NVR systems to customer's specifications

Inventory Control

  • Conduct periodic physical inventory counting and reconciling process
  • Report discrepancies accurately and in a timely manner
